1. Assessing Tree Risks: Identifying Threats Before They Happen

Recognizing Structural Weaknesses

Trees often appear healthy while concealing internal decay or structural weaknesses. Leaning trunks, cracked bark, or fungal growth frequently indicate compromised stability. Professional arborists assess these conditions using specialized tools, industry knowledge, and years of experience. Their expertise allows them to identify trees posing imminent risks to homes, vehicles, or outdoor structures. Early detection ensures safety while preventing damage, allowing property owners to make informed decisions regarding removal or treatment of hazardous trees.

Impact of Severe Weather

Suffolk County experiences seasonal storms, heavy winds, and snow loads that worsen the vulnerability of weakened trees. Professionals evaluate external factors such as wind direction, soil erosion, and water saturation to determine structural risk. This assessment helps predict how trees may respond during storms, reducing sudden collapses and unexpected damage. Proper evaluation ensures that homeowners are protected from preventable accidents. 2. Disease and Pest Management: Maintaining a Healthy Landscape

Identifying Tree Diseases

Tree diseases such as root rot, canker, or blight spread quickly and threaten neighboring plants. Professional arborists are trained to identify early symptoms that homeowners may overlook, including leaf discoloration, abnormal growth patterns, or premature leaf drop. Early detection allows for targeted interventions, preserving landscape health. By removing or treating diseased trees promptly, professionals prevent further damage, ensuring the safety, aesthetic appeal, and ecological balance of the property, while maintaining overall plant health.

Controlling Pest Infestations

Insects like emerald ash borers, bark beetles, and aphids infest trees, compromising structural integrity and spreading to other plants. Expert tree removal services incorporate pest management strategies to prevent infestations from harming the broader property. By combining removal with pest control, professionals maintain landscape health and reduce the risk of future outbreaks. Effective monitoring and strategic intervention protect the property from invasive pests, ensuring trees and surrounding flora remain strong, visually appealing, and environmentally sustainable over time.

5. Storm Preparedness: Proactive Protection Measures

Mitigating Hurricane and Windstorm Damage

Suffolk County experiences seasonal storms, including hurricanes and nor’easters, posing significant risks to trees and property. Trees with weak roots, unstable limbs, or disease can fall during storms, causing extensive damage. Professional arborists evaluate tree stability and remove high-risk trees proactively, reducing potential property loss. By addressing hazards before storms, homeowners protect homes, vehicles, and landscaping from destructive impacts. Expert evaluation and removal minimize emergencies, ensuring safer properties during extreme weather events common in the region.

Strategic Placement and Pruning

Beyond removal, professionals advise on pruning, bracing, and selective thinning to improve wind resistance and reduce potential hazards. Proper pruning prevents branches from impacting structures and maintains tree health, creating safer outdoor environments. Strategic thinning and removal also allow sunlight penetration, improving plant vitality. These measures protect homes, fences, decks, and garages from storm damage while enhancing overall landscape aesthetics and ensuring long-term safety for residents and property.
